According to Coluna Do Fla, Italy named their squad for the 2026 World Cup play-offs on Friday 20 March, with coach Gattuso omitting Flamengo midfielder Jorginho.
The Italo-Brazilian will not face Northern Ireland on 26 March in the European play-offs.
He remains available to Leonardo Jardim during the international window, reducing the risk of him missing Bragantino. Flamengo v Bragantino is scheduled for one April, a date that could change. Had he been called, he would have faced the physical load of the tie and travel from Italy to report back in time.
Goalkeepers Caprile, Carnesecchi, Donnarumma, Meret. Defenders Bastoni, Buongiorno, Calafiori, Cambiaso, Coppola, Dimarco, Gatti, Mancini, Palestra, Scalvini, Spinazzola. Midfielders Barella, Cristante, Frattesi, Locatelli, Pisilli, Tonali. Forwards Chiesa, F. P. Esposito, Kean, Politano, Raspadori, Retegui, Scamacca.
Although included on a provisional list, his last spell with the Azzurra came in 2024, when the side were set to play the Nations League.
Italy last played at a World Cup in 2014, so the Flamengo midfielder has yet to feature at the tournament. For him to do so, Italy must overcome Northern Ireland and then select him in the final squad. Defeat would leave the Europeans 16 years without a World Cup appearance.
At Flamengo, the Brazilian trio Alex Sandro, Léo Pereira and Danilo are currently the only call-ups for this window. Uruguay are expected to summon Arrascaeta, De La Cruz and Guillermo Varela.
